Coohom Cloud was established by Koolab Innovation Laboratory of MANYCORE TECH INC. in 2017, after realizing that many industries were on the verge of significant investments in high-quality data. MANYCORE TECH INC. is a leading global cloud based interior design software platform, Coohom Cloud leverages its parent company MANYCORE TECH INC.’s extensive indoor data resources, combined with high-performance rendering engines and advanced data processing technologies, to deliver realistic and physically accurate 2D and 3D interior datasets and services to the AI industry.

In 2018, MANYCORE TECH INC. collaborated with Imperial College London and the University of Southern California to introduce the InteriorNet, which was then the largest publicly available indoor scene dataset. Building upon this, the MANYCORE TECH INC.’s platform now generate over 400,000 3D designs daily and houses approximately 360 million 3D models, encompassing furniture, appliances, household items, and more. This forms a robust data foundation provided by Coohom Cloud for research in indoor environment understanding, 3D reconstruction, robotics simulation and beyond.

Regarding 2D image rendering technology, Coohom Cloud employs a proprietary rendering engine to capture image data in diverse indoor settings through adjusting camera parameters, path trajectories, lighting conditions, etc., resulting in 2D datasets in formats such as RGB, depth, semantic, normal, point cloud, and others. This capability allows Coohom Cloud to produce 300,000 sets of 2D datasets daily, serving as ample training materials for AI agents’ navigation, visual perception, and environmental understanding capabilities.

To provide cost-effective data service solutions, Coohom Cloud utilizes its self-developed data processing engine designed for efficient data transformation, converting the accumulated database into formats suitable for AI training. This data engine can offer more comprehensive support on the physical, diversity, and data labeling fronts.

Physical Enhancement: Embodied intelligence’s real-world interactive capabilities are a key indicator of its level of intelligence. Coohom Cloud integrates cutting-edge simulation platforms like NVIDIA Isaac Sim to create 3D environments with realistic physical properties, allowing robots to undergo extensive interaction testing within a virtual realm. This significantly reduces training costs, enhances training safety, and improves repeatability.

Environment Augmentation: Coohom Cloud’s environment enhancement tool enriches the complexity of virtual environments through model element diversification, material variations, as well as lighting adjustments, etc. to simulate the diversity and complexity of the real world, enhancing the adaptability and generalization ability of robots.

Segmentation & Annotation: Coohom Cloud utilizes advanced synthetic data generation techniques to customize segmentation and annotation data, supporting various labels such as semantics, materials, spatial states. This approach significantly enhances data processing efficiency and accuracy.

Unlike conventional AI assistants that respond only when prompted, MoClaw gives each user a persistent cloud computer. Agents drive browsers, manage files, run code, remember prior context, reuse skills, and execute recurring tasks — all without the user being present. With transparent bring-your-own-key model access, customers connect their own AI provider keys and pay those providers directly, with no markup from MoClaw on model usage.

Agents need infrastructure. Running them reliably means renting a server, configuring dependencies, and writing recovery logic — or leaving a laptop open around the clock. MoClaw removes that overhead. Each agent, its tools, and its runtime live in a managed, sandboxed environment that stays on whether the user is online or not.

Users assign work through the web, Telegram, or Slack. From there, agents navigate websites, extract data, fill forms, generate documents, and return results to the user’s preferred channel. Because each agent carries persistent memory and a library of more than 50 reusable skills — from browser control and web research to document handling and code execution — it builds on prior work instead of starting from scratch each session. Scheduled tasks run at set intervals; on-demand tasks fire immediately.

BANGKOK, June 17, 2026 /PRNewswire/ — InfoComm Asia, Asia-Pacific’s premier professional audiovisual and integrated experience platform, today announced the release of its new Asia-Pacific Pro AV Market Playbook 2026, a comprehensive industry report examining the technological, economic, and market forces transforming the region’s professional audiovisual landscape.

Developed by InfoComm Asia with insights from the 2025 Industry Outlook and Trends Analysis (IOTA) produced by AVIXA (Audiovisual and Integrated Experience Association), the whitepaper provides executives, technology decision-makers, system integrators, consultants, manufacturers, and end users with critical insights into the rapid evolution of Asia-Pacific’s digital economy and the growing role of Pro AV technologies in driving business transformation.

According to data highlighted, the Asia-Pacific Pro AV market represents a US$123.7 billion opportunity today and is projected to reach US$151.4 billion by 2030.

The report examines emerging opportunities created by the convergence of artificial intelligence, AV-over-IP infrastructures, immersive technologies, smart buildings, and integrated digital ecosystems. It also highlights how government initiatives, digital transformation programs, and infrastructure investments are accelerating technology adoption across key Asia-Pacific markets.
